2. EDM in Manufacturing: Electrical Discharge Machining Shops

If you’re seeking machine shops that offer EDM (Electrical Discharge Machining), you’re likely in search of high-precision manufacturing for parts that can’t be made by traditional methods. These shops specialize in:

  • Wire EDM: Uses a thin wire to cut intricate shapes in metal components.
  • Sinker (Ram) EDM: Forms complex cavities using customized electrodes.
  • Small Hole EDM: Drills precise micro-holes in hard metals.

  1. Review Shop Specializations
    Many shops highlight their processes (Wire EDM, Sinker EDM) and materials worked with (steel, aluminum, exotic alloys) on their websites or business profiles. This helps to match their expertise with your needs.

  2. Check Certifications and Capabilities
    Certified shops often deliver higher precision and better quality assurance. Look for certifications such as ISO or NADCAP for aerospace, medical, or industrial projects.

  3. Request Consultation or Quotes
    Don’t hesitate to call or email for a quote. Share your project drawings or ideas—reputable shops assist with feasibility and cost estimates.

Benefits of Choosing a Local EDM Machine Shop

  • Faster Turnaround: Proximity often allows for quicker project completion and shipping.
  • Face-to-Face Communication: In-person meetings help avoid misunderstandings.
  • Support Local Industry: Supporting nearby businesses stimulates local economies.

Challenges and Practical Tips

  • Limited Local Options: Not all areas have specialized EDM shops; you may need to consider shops within your region.
  • Capacity Constraints: Some smaller shops may be booked with large projects. Always ask about lead times.
  • Technical Requirements: Be clear about tolerances, materials, and quantities from the start.

Best Practices

  • Prepare Project Details: Have technical drawings or digital files ready for quotes.
  • Inquire About Tooling and Setup Fees: Some jobs incur non-recurring engineering charges.
  • Ask for Sample Work: Reviewing previous projects can help you gauge quality.

EDM Machine Shops

  • Get Multiple Quotes: Pricing can vary based on equipment, material, and shop expertise.
  • Local vs. Shipping: Nearby shops often save you shipping costs and reduce risks of damage during transit. But sometimes, even with shipping, distant shops with bulk capabilities offer better per-unit pricing for large orders.
  • Batch Your Orders: Grouping multiple parts in one order can reduce setup and unit costs.
  • Check for Minimum Order Quantities (MOQs): Some shops have MOQs for cost efficiency.
